A landmark reference work in the field of archaeology, Archaeological Atlas of the World presents a comprehensive cartographic survey of human prehistory and history across the globe. Illustrated with 103 specially drawn maps by John Woodcock and Shalom Schotten, the atlas charts the locations of significant archaeological sites from the earliest traces of human activity through to the emergence of complex civilisations. David and Ruth Whitehouse bring authoritative scholarship to bear, guiding readers across continents and millennia with clarity and precision. The work serves as an indispensable companion for students, academics, and enthusiasts seeking a structured, geographic understanding of the ancient world. Authoritative in tone and exhaustive in scope, it remains a definitive resource for anyone tracing the material footprint of human history.
